WWW.MANUALS.WS Owner's Manual WWW.MANUALS.WS WWW.MANUALS.WS Introduction The aim of this Owner's Manual is to help you get the best value from your vehicle and to provide information on routine maintenance. We advise you to read it carefully before setting out. The Owner's Manual is an integral part of the vehicle and it must therefore always be kept on board. This manual refers to vehicles with two types of transmission: · F1 electronically-controlled gearbox · mechanical gearbox Therefore some information may vary depending on the gearbox installed. WWW.MANUALS.WS 2 WWW.MANUALS.WS Spare parts When replacing parts or topping up with lubricants and fluids, we recommend you use original spare parts and the lubricants and fluids recommended by Ferrari. The Ferrari warranty is voided if Original Ferrari Spare Parts are not used for repairs. Chassis The chassis of this vehicle is entirely constructed of aluminium. If the chassis is damaged in an accident, have it repaired at the FERRARI SERVICE NETWORK only. Using non-original spare parts and having inexpert persons carry out repairs may have serious consequences for the vehicle. In normal conditions of use the chassis does not require any maintenance; it is however advisable to contact the Ferrari Service Network at the intervals indicated in the Service Time Schedule in order to have it checked. Should emergency repairs be required, it is advisable to have the vehicle checked by the Ferrari Service Network as soon as possible. F1 gearbox Warning: The vehicle may be fitted with an electro-hydraulicallycontrolled gearbox system, driven by means of levers on the steering wheel. Even though the system can be used in "Automatic" mode, it should not be considered an automatic gearbox. Hence, for proper use always follow the instructions given in this manual on page 70. Stud bolt pre-tightening Stud bolt final tightening 35÷40 Nm 100 Nm Spare wheel Tyre (max. speed 80 km/h) Pirelli T 115/70 R19" Inflation pressure (cold) 4,2 bar (62 psi) WWW.MANUALS.WS 12 1 - General WWW.MANUALS.WS information "Run flat" tyres (optional) The vehicle can be fitted with "Run Flat" tyres. This type of tyre has reinforced sidewalls which permit the vehicle to continue travelling at a moderate speed (80 km/h - 50 mph) for a set distance, even in the event of a puncture. Always comply with the specified wheel alignment values, as this is fundamental to obtain the best performance from and the longest life of your tyres. Further information on these tyres and the relevant pressure monitoring system can be found in the "Scaglietti Bodywork" Owner's manual. WWW.MANUALS.WS 14 2 WWW.MANUALS.WS- About your vehicle Keys _______________________________ 16 Alarm system ________________________ 16 Steering wheel controls _______________ 21 Instrument panel _____________________ 29 Warning lights _______________________ 32 Multi-function display _________________ 34 Dashboard controls ___________________ 36 Controls on the tunnel ________________ 43 Doors_______________________________ 46 Seat controls _________________________ 47 Interior rearview mirror ________________ 49 Safety ______________________________ 50 Seat belts ___________________________ 51 Airbag ______________________________ 55 Passenger compartment accessories _____ 57 Internal lights ________________________ 59 Hands-free microphone (optional) _______ 59 Engine compartment lid _______________ 60 Air conditioning and heating system _____ 61 WWW.MANUALS.WS 15 WWW.MANUALS.WS Keys The vehicle is delivered with two identical keys. Write the code number of the key in the space provided in the warranty booklet. A duplicate of the keys can be requested communicating the identification number to the Ferrari Service Network. Key codes A CODE CARD is supplied with the keys. This card indicates the following: - the electronic code to be used for "emergency starting"; - the mechanical code for the keys, to be given to the Ferrari Service Network in the case that you request duplicates of the keys. The code numbers shown on the CODE CARD should be kept in a safe place. You are advised to always keep the CODE CARD number with you, as this is absolutely necessary in the event of an "emergency start". In the event of a vehicle ownership transfer, it is essential that the new owner is provided with all the keys and with the CODE CARD. You are advised to record and keep the codes listed on the tags delivered with the keys and the remote control in a safe place (not in the vehicle) in order to request duplicates if needed. Alarm system FERRARI CODE system For greater protection against theft, the vehicle is equipped with an electronic engine immobilizer system (Ferrari CODE), which is automatically activated when the ignition key is removed. Each ignition key contains an electronic device which transmits a code signal to the Ferrari CODE control unit, and engine ignition is enabled only if the key code is acknowledged by the system. Two keys are supplied with the vehicle. The key serves to: - lock/unlock the doors (central door locking) - activate/deactivate the passenger airbag (not present in Australian and Japanese versions) - activate/deactivate the alarm.
